SUMMARY:Cal Poly to Exhibit Photographs by Clint Baclawski
DESCRIPTION:An exhibit titled “Lush\,” featuring the work of photographer Clint Baclawski\, will open in the University Gallery in the Dexter Building (No. 34) at Cal Poly.  \n“Instead of using gallery lights to illuminate a flat image on a wall\, Clint’s photos emanate light from within\, giving them a substance that is normally associated with sculpture\,” said gallery specialist Garet Zook. “The light spectrum that moves through the prints fills the room with its luminescence\, creating a space that is in its entirety an experience.” \nThis exhibition represents Baclawski’s most ambitious work to date. The University Art Gallery will be filled with 64 panels of 128 LED bulbs. The 128 linear feet of images were photographed near Boston and feature blades of grass on a soccer field. The entire image captures the length of the field; corner post to corner post. Within the room\, visitors will see a full range of color variants\, including the lushest greens and the bluest of blue skies\, ending in negative colors; purple and yellow with a full black-and-white transition in between.  \nThe University Art Gallery is free and open to the public from 11 a.m. to 4 p.m. Tuesday through Saturday. It is located on the ground floor near the entrance to the Dexter Building.

SUMMARY:Cal Poly Arts Presents Carol Williams Forbes Pipe Organ Recital
DESCRIPTION:Carol Williams has performed around the world\, collaborating with pop and rock bands as well as numerous prestigious international orchestras. When she was appointed “Civic Organist” for the City of San Diego in 2001\, she became the first woman to receive that distinction in an American city. And she was re-appointed in 2011 for another 10 years! The British- born organist is on a mission to bring the pipe organ to new audiences by offering a different spin through programs of intense genre diversity. Her program will include original compositions\, jazz and blues-based pieces\, as well as some grand classical works.
